[0037] The method of ultrasonic non-destructive measurement of wear-resistant coating thickness and elastic modulus is as follows: figure 1 The one shown includes a water tank 1, a sample table 2, a wear-resistant coating sample 3, a water immersion focusing probe 4, an X-Y-Z three-dimensional step control device 5, an ultrasonic flaw detector 6, a digital oscilloscope 7, and an ultrasonic pulse echo of a computer 8 A system for measuring the thickness and modulus of elasticity of wear-resistant coatings. The specific implementation steps are as follows:
[0038] Step a, determine the incident angle α: put a stainless steel sample with a thickness of h=1.62mm on the sample stage 2 in the water tank 1, and use the X-Y-Z three-dimensional step control device 5 to adjust the distance between the water immersion focusing probe 4 and the sample.
